      Senior Android Developer – Drone Navigation & Control

      In this function, you will play a pivotal role in developing and maintaining our 3DX™ Blade Platform. We value a hands-on approach and a “get things done” mindset and the ability to work creatively and solve complex problems. As a Senior Android Developer, you interact with different internal stakeholders to design and implement high quality software.

       Key Responsibilities

      • Design, develop and maintain Android applications for drone navigation and control
      • Integrate the DJI Mobile SDK (and similar SDKs) to deliver reliable flight and mission control
      • Provide technical support to drone pilots during field operations
      • Drive a product from concept to customer release, contributing to the entire software development lifecycle – from planning and design to testing and deployment

        About You  

      • 5+ years of professional experience in Android development
      • University degree in Engineering or similar
      • Hands-on experience with the DJI Mobile SDK or comparable control SDKs for robotics
      • Proven track record of delivering production-ready software
      • Strong understanding of geospatial reasoning and spatial data
      • Willingness to provide 3rd level support to drone pilots in the field
      • Fluent in English, German is a plus
      • C#/.NET programming experience is a plus
